Former Neighbours actor Craig McLachlan has been cleared of allegations that he assaulted four women during a stage show. The 55-year-old star was found not guilty of all 13 charges during a hearing at Melbourne Magistrates’ Court on Tuesday. One of Europe’s largest vertical farms is up and running in a warehouse near Copenhagen, and it’s powered by wind. That’s not surprising, since Denmark has the highest proportion of wind power in the world.
